I can't remember for sure when I first saw one. It was either late 60's or early 70's at Kansas State fair when I was in high school or shortly after. It was on display at an equipment booth. Was an impressive tractor for the day.

Way bigger than anything even imaginable for use in our area of SE Kansas at the time when a 4020 was a big tractor (were only 2 5020 sold in our immediate area that I know of). Now it would be just big enough to pull the larger planters in the area but too small for big tillage. Times change!

Seems like it was a hillside version but can't remember for sure. I may have seen picture of that later in a magazine. I do remember picking up a piece of literature on it.

At that time before big farm shows became popular, state fairs were the place to see the latest and greatest in machinery. Always looked forward to that FFA Vo-Ag trip.
